Overriding VRU Settings
You can override a default VRU setting on a call-by-call basis by using the VRU Settings node
(in the Queue tab of the Palette).
Figure 92: The VRU Settings Icon
You can only override one VRU setting with the VRU Settings node; you must use additional
nodes to override additional settings.
Following is the Properties dialog box for the VRU Settings node:
Figure 93: VRU Settings Properties
Define VRU Settings node properties as follows:
1. In the VRU Variable list, select the VRU variable to override.
2. Select an option in the Set To field:
Select ICM Configured Setting to have Script Editor, at runtime, set the variable to
the value stored in the VRU_Defaults table.
